The Environmental Health Association of Québec (ASEQ‑EHAQ) is a nonprofit organization dedicated to achieving equity, inclusion, and accessibility for people living with the medical condition and disability of multiple chemical sensitivity (MCS). ASEQ-EHAQ promotes support, education, research, and advocacy to support accessibility, and eliminate poverty, isolation, and discrimination experienced by this population.
ASEQ-EHAQ provides information and collaborate with governments, health professionals, academics, and community groups to advance services, accommodations, and public policies that reduce toxic exposures and safeguard health. ASEQ-EHAQ also conducts and supports research on environmental health and MCS, promotes knowledge translation, and develops healthy, affordable housing adapted for people with MCS and overlapping conditions. ASEQ-EHAQ's work fosters partnerships worldwide to build healthier, more inclusive environments.

The International Society of Doctors for the Environment (ISDE) is a global umbrella organization of national initiatives of medical doctors. The main purpose of ISDE is to help defend our environment both locally and globally to prevent numerous illnesses, ensure the necessary conditions for health, and improve the quality of life.
In order to safeguard the health of our own generation and of future ones, we must care for the environment. ISDE was established as a tool for educating and updating physicians and the general public, and stimulating awareness and initiatives by public and private bodies, in particular governmental agencies. The Association intends to reach out to all, as fellow citizens of the world.
